Isleworth Station may be petite, but it ensures smooth rail travel for all passengers. While there is no traditional ticket office, ticket machines are present for the collection of online purchases. These machines are equipped to provide the best service to customers with disabilities, offering tickets with Disabled Persons Railcard discounts.
While the station lacks some conveniences such as waiting rooms, seating areas, and refreshment facilities, it compensates with step-free access, making it partially accessible for individuals with mobility concerns. Commuters can feel reassured with the presence of CCTV and customer help points, enhancing safety at the station.

Although Manors Station does not boast an extensive array of modern facilities, it covers the basics tailored for urban commuters. There isn't a ticket office, yet you'll find ticket machines ready to serve your purchasing and collection needs. These machines are accessible for all, featuring an induction loop for hearing-impaired travelers as well. If you opt for a smartcard journey, there are smartcard validators available. However, you won't find any staffed assistance or customer information desk, so keep the helpline (0800 200 6060) handy for any urgent queries.
Travelers seeking comfort must note the absence of basic amenities. There are no waiting rooms, toilets, food, or shopping outlets at the station. Nonetheless, the station is safeguarded with CCTV coverage and offers bike storage facilities with options like stands and lockers.
Manors Station is a Category C station, which implies it lacks step-free access, making it challenging for travelers with mobility impairments. The only access to platforms is through a footbridge, and there are no tactile pavings available. If you require any assistance, conductors are available to help you as you wait on the platform. The station offers several convenient transport links. There is a bus stop close to the station, making it easier to catch local services, and for those needing a taxi, more information can be found at Northern Railway's cab service. Additionally, travelers can access the Tyne & Wear Metro station nearby, an efficient link for reaching Sunderland or catching flights at Newcastle Airport via the Nexus Tyne & Wear trains.
